Proper Storage of LiFePO4 Batteries: A Comprehensive Guide LiFePO4 batteries are a popular choice for their eco-friendly and long-lasting properties. However, their storage requirements are often overlooked, which can lead to reduced performance, damage, and even safety risks. Proper storage of LiFePO4 batteries is crucial to maintain their integrity and extend their lifespan. In this article, we will delve into the best practices for storing LiFePO4 batteries to ensure optimal performance and longevity. Temperature Control: One of the most critical factors in LiFePO4 storage is temperature. Operating temperatures between 20°C to 25°C (68°F to 77°F) are recommended, with a maximum temperature limit of 30°C (86°F). Avoid storing batteries in extreme temperatures, as this can cause chemical reactions and damage the battery. Charge Level: The optimal charge level for storage is between 20% to 80% State of Charge (SOC). Avoid deep discharging or overcharging, as this can cause internal resistance, reducing the battery's overall performance. Avoid Corrosive Materials: Corrosive materials, such as acids and alkalis, should be kept away from LiFePO4 batteries. Moisture and humidity can also cause corrosion, reducing the battery's lifespan. Regular Inspection: Regularly inspect the batteries for signs of physical damage, corrosion, or other signs of distress. Make sure to store them in a clean and dry environment, away from any flammable materials. Accurate Labeling: Accurate labeling of the stored batteries is essential. Include information about the type of battery, storage conditions, and any specific storage requirements. By implementing these best practices for storing LiFePO4 batteries, you can ensure optimal performance, extend the lifespan of your batteries, and maintain a safe and reliable storage environment. Remember, proper storage is key to unlocking the full potential of your LiFePO4 batteries.
